Conference Article: Analysis of the core seismic experiments using the SAFA program for intercomparison of LMFBR seismic analysis codes
Horiuchi, T. (Hitachi Ltd, Tsuchiura, Ibaraki (Japan). Mechanical Engineering Research Lab.)Abstract
As a project of the IAEA/IWGFR, a coordinated research program on intercomputison of LMFBR seismic analysis codes has been undertaken since 1991. In this research program, the participants conducted calculations on PEC, MONJU and HAPSODIE problems using their own computer programs. As a final report for the coordinated research program, the results calculated using the SAFA program developed by Hitachi, Ltd. are reviewed. Since the calculation results were found to correlate well with the ones measured during comparisons, the validity of SAFA for the seismic-response analysis of an FBR core was demonstrated. Intercomparison of computer codes and some recommendations for future research are also made.
